Early American Obsolete Half Cents Minted 1793 to 1857 Early American Half Cents are one of the most fascinating of all U.S. coin series. These early copper obsolete coins were first issued in 1793 with mintage continuing for most years through 1857, with numerous Types and Varieties issued. All Half Cents are scarce in all grades. An exciting early issue a piece of our early American heritage. Flowing Hair Half Cent: Minted 1793. Liberty Cap Half Cent: Minted 1794 to 1797. Draped Bust Half Cent: Minted 1800 to 1808. Classic Half Cent: Minted 1809 to 1836. Braided Hair Half Cent: Minted 1849 to 1857.
